Serves meat, vegan options available. Serves freshly filled, made to order bagels. Offers various vegan bagels including the New Yorker with vegan cheese and vegan pastrami, the vegan Swiss mountain with vegan emmental, vegan ham and vegan mayo and the vegan game changer with Moving Mountains burger and vegan cheddar. Open Mon-Sat 09:30-15:30, Sun 10:00-15:30.

Disappointed

Such a disappointment. The I went for the vegan New Yorker. The menu, described it as being pastrami, smoked cheese, American mustard & gherkins. I sat at my table and I open the container (served in takeaway boxes), to a sad looking bagel with quorn ham, a square of plain vegan cheese, lots of American mustard & gherkins. The quorn ham was just awful, not a fan of quorn away, but there is some incredible meat subs including an excellent pastrami, and they used quorn, & a plain vegan cheese, when there are so many good options now! Bagel was mega dry and just crumbled. Definitely would not go back. Guy on the till was nice and friendly though.

Great selection and service

Their menu is laid out in such a way that it shows which bagels can be made Vegan. If they don't have a certain ingredient they will do their best to offer suggestions or alternatives.

Seating area outside is nice too, good place to escape the heat and the gulls!

Lots of exciting & tasty vegan options

Really struggled to choose which bagel to have. Vegan options includes a new yorker style bagel, blt, and mushroom madness one. I had the mushroom which had truffle mayo and vegan cheeseand was deliciously saucey. Did have to have a plain bagel though - would be nice to have more interesting vegan option. Bagel and flat white with oat came to around £10. We sat inside in a very nice interior.
